A suitable unit for gravitational constant is
Text Solution
Verified by ExpertsThe correct answer is:
C
\(F = \frac{G m_1 m_2}{d^2}\)
\(G = \frac{F d^2}{m \cdot m_2} = \mathrm{Nm}^2 / \mathrm{kg}^2\)
